    Wounds and the Justice Health system

    Wounds and the Justice Health system

    Correctional facilities in Australia are home to over 40,000 people, and wounds are a significant issue.  From self-harm and stabbings, to leg ulcers and diabetic feet, the mix is quite unique.  This week the Wound Doctors talk to Justice Health Nurses, Linda and Nicki, who discuss the types of wounds that affect people who are incarcerated, and explain how these wounds are looked after.   This episode lifts the lid on wounds ‘on the inside’ and highlights the exceptional work of those nurses who deliver healthcare in correctional facilities.

    Wounds and Public Health

    Wounds and Public Health

    Kate McBride is an Epidemiologist and operates in the higher echelons of public health.  Today the Wound Doctors interrogate Kate (in a nice way), to find out why wounds, which cost Australia over $3 billion a year, are NOT a public health priority, and what needs to be done to address this.
